[Platform deprecation][Google] Add Android Location Button before 2027-01-27 #5667

Description

@shai-almog

Impact summary

Urgency: High. From 2027-01-27, Google Play requires apps targeting Android 17 (API level 37)+ to use the Android Location Button for transactional, one-time precise-location use cases. Persistent ACCESS_FINE_LOCATION remains available only for justified core functionality and requires a Play Console declaration.

Codename One currently treats all foreground location use as broad precise-location permission use: referencing the location API injects ACCESS_FINE_LOCATION and ACCESS_COARSE_LOCATION, and obtaining the Android LocationManager unconditionally checks ACCESS_FINE_LOCATION. One-shot CN1 calls such as getCurrentLocationSync() therefore have no policy-compliant Location Button path.

Official requirement and deadline

Hard policy enforcement deadline: 2027-01-27.

First affected platform/store combination: Google Play apps targeting Android 17 / API 37+ that need one-time/session precise location, or that retain ACCESS_FINE_LOCATION without an approved persistent core-use justification.

Concrete Codename One applicability

Verified against codenameone/CodenameOnemaster at 134f6ec227792da11b595a77eda6c06d3c0a2b8f:

  • CodenameOne/src/com/codename1/location/LocationManager.java
    • Exposes one-shot getCurrentLocation* flows as well as continuous listeners and background/geofence APIs, but does not distinguish policy-minimized session access.
  • Ports/Android/src/com/codename1/impl/android/AndroidImplementation.java
    • getLocationManager() unconditionally checks Manifest.permission.ACCESS_FINE_LOCATION before returning the native manager.
  • Ports/Android/src/com/codename1/location/AndroidLocationManager.java
    • Requests normal GPS/provider updates; there is no system Location Button session or temporary permission flow.
  • maven/codenameone-maven-plugin/src/main/java/com/codename1/builders/AndroidGradleBuilder.java
    • Location API detection emits both ACCESS_FINE_LOCATION and ACCESS_COARSE_LOCATION into the generated manifest without USE_LOCATION_BUTTON or an onlyForLocationButton flag.
  • codenameone/BuildDaemonmaster at 09cd713c6abe9455d0574ed0a1ff0776bee84754
    • AndroidBuilder, AndroidGradleBuilder, and PermissionInjections mirror broad location permission generation for hosted builds.
  • No USE_LOCATION_BUTTON, onlyForLocationButton, androidx.core.locationbutton, or platform Location Button implementation exists on the default branch.

Deduplication across open and closed issues/PRs used Location Button, USE_LOCATION_BUTTON, onlyForLocationButton, API 37, 2027-01-27, and the official notice name. No tracking item or completed migration was found.

Affected users and failure mode

  • CN1 apps targeting API 37+ that use one-time precise location for nearby search, address fill, tagging, or one-time sharing.
  • Apps with continuous navigation, tracking, geofence, or background location can retain broad access only when it is core functionality and properly declared.
  • Failure mode: Play policy declaration/review burden; update rejection or policy enforcement for one-time use implemented with broad permission; or a broken location feature if the app removes ACCESS_FINE_LOCATION without a CN1 Location Button path.

Proposed migration

  1. Investigation/API design
    • Define a CN1 UI/API seam for a system-rendered Location Button and session-scoped result, distinct from persistent LocationManager listeners.
    • Decide fallback semantics for Android <=16 and for non-Android platforms without weakening Android 17 policy behavior.
  2. Implementation
    • Integrate the AndroidX Location Button (or stable platform boundary) and route its granted session into a one-shot CN1 location result.
    • Inject USE_LOCATION_BUTTON and the correct onlyForLocationButton flag only for picker-only flows; do not inject unrestricted ACCESS_FINE_LOCATION for those apps.
    • Preserve existing continuous/background/geofence APIs and document their Play declaration obligations.
    • Add any compile SDK 37/toolchain requirement to Maven and BuildDaemon in a coordinated change.
  3. CI and beta validation
    • Add manifest-generation tests for button-only versus persistent location use.
    • Test grant, denial, cancellation, configuration change, session expiry, process/activity recreation, and fallback behavior.
    • Validate Android 17 gesture/UI behavior on device/emulator and both Maven/local and BuildDaemon/hosted AAB generation.
  4. Release and communication
    • Ship framework, builder, and BuildDaemon support together.
    • Publish a migration example for getCurrentLocationSync()-style one-time use and a separate declaration checklist for persistent location apps.

Internal target dates

  • 90-day checkpoint / API and dependency decision: 2026-10-29
  • 60-day checkpoint / implementation complete: 2026-11-28
  • Android 17 UI, CI, and hosted-build validation complete: 2026-12-14
  • Release and customer communication no later than 2026-12-28, preserving the required 30-day buffer before 2027-01-27 enforcement

Risks, unknowns, and verification plan

  • The official guide currently calls the AndroidX Location Button library experimental; pin and retest the chosen version before release.
  • A native system-rendered button must fit CN1 layout/lifecycle semantics without being covered, restyled incompatibly, or detached during form transitions.
  • The manifest flag must not coexist incorrectly with persistent fine-location use in the same app; define an explicit conflict/upgrade rule.
  • BuildCloud does not yet show an API 37 default image in the inspected BuildDaemon source; direct API 37 compilation needs coordinated toolchain availability.
  • Verify Play Console pre-launch/policy checks, Android 17 session-only access after button tap, denial/revocation, older-device fallback, and persistent-location declaration documentation.
